    Hi HN, Matvey, Ildar, Joey, and Dominik here. If you're building LLM agents that use tools, you're probably worried about prompt injection attacks that can hijack those tools. We were too, and found that solutions like prompt-based filtering or secondary "guard" LLMs can be unreliable. Our thesis is that agent security should be handled at the network level between the agent and the LLM, just like a traditional web application firewall. So we built Archestra Platform: an open-source gateway that acts as a secure proxy for your AI agents. It's designed to be a deterministic firewall against…

    Hi HN, I’m the creator of Cordum. I’ve been working in DevOps and infrastructure for years (currently in the fintech/security space), and as I started playing with AI agents, I noticed a scary pattern. Most "safety" mechanisms rely on system prompts ("Please don't do X") or flimsy Python logic inside the agent itself. If we treat agents as autonomous employees, giving them root access and hoping they listen to instructions felt insane to me. I wanted a way to enforce hard constraints that the LLM cannot override, no matter how "jailbroken" it gets. So I built Cordum. It’s an open-source…

    Latch is an open-source proxy that sits between AI agents and the tools they use. It intercepts all tool calls and applies security policies in real-time: Safe operations pass through instantly. Risky operations require human approval via dashboard or Telegram. Dangerous operations are blocked completely I built Latch to address the growing security risks of AI agents accessing critical systems. There have been 1,800+ exposed agent gateways discovered in the wild and recent security audits showing multiple vulnerabilities in agent frameworks, so this was motivated by the clear urgent need…

    Hey HN! For that last 8 months I've been trying to make agents that can hack web applications to find vulnerabilities in them - An AI Security Tester. The system has 29 agents in total, a custom LLM Orchestration framework which works on the task-subtask architecture (old-school but works amazingly for my use case, and is pretty reliable) with custom agent calling mechanism. No Auo-Gen, Langchain and Crew AI - Everything custom built for pentesting. Each test runs in an isolated Kali linux environment (on AWS Fargate), where the agents have full access to the environment to undertake any…
